    Bev Vance's relationships have played a crucial role in shaping her life and the lives of those around her. Her marriage to JD Vance's father ended in divorce, leading to a series of tumultuous relationships that further complicated her family dynamics.

    The social and economic context in which JD Vance's mother lived has had a significant impact on her life and the lives of those around her. The decline of manufacturing jobs and the rise of economic inequality in America's Rust Belt have created significant challenges for working-class families. Understanding these broader societal issues is essential for addressing the root causes of personal and familial struggles.
